An observational study to evaluate the pattern of multiple drug resistance pathogens (Extended-Spectrum β-lactamases Producing Strains, Carbapenem Resistant Enterobacteriaceae and Methicillin Resistant Staphylococcus Aureus) seen in hospital acquired pneumonia patients admitted in tertiary care centres across India. - ASPI

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Patient is >= 18 years of age and 2. The patient has been diagnosed as Hospital Acquired Pneumonia (HAP) as per CDC /NHSN Surveillance definition. 3. Bacteriological culture and sensitivity report showing presence of at least one causative pathogen. 4. Signed Informed consent obtained prior to any study related procedures.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Are currently enrolled in, or discontinued within the last 30 days from, a clinical trial involving an investigational product or concurrently enrolled in any other type of medical research.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
1. To evaluate the anti-microbial sensitivity pattern of MDR pathogens (ESBL producing strains, CREs and MRSAs) from patients with hospital acquired pneumonia. 2. To study the predisposing factors for MDR pathogens in these patients. Timepoint: Not applicable
